What is a LCSW?
LCSW represents certified scientific social worker. They are social workers who have gone on to acquire their master’s in social work (MSW) and complete the requirements in their state to get their professional license. By getting their MSW and license, they can operate in a range of environments, explore various expertises, and even open up their own private practice.

What does a Licensed Scientific Social Worker Do?
A licensed scientific social worker provides treatment to clients with emotional and mental issuesExternal link: open_in_new that are affecting their every day lives. They work with their customers to listen to their needs and offer the assistance and resources needed to cope with those problems.

LCSWs likewise have the capability to diagnose and deal with the issues of their clients, although this may vary by state. This can be in the form of providing treatment, supplying recommendations, and dealing with other specialists like medical professionals to come up with an effective treatment plan for their customer.

Where do LCSWs work?
LCSWs can work in a variety of settings. Some operate in offices for research study purposes, and others may visit their customers in schools, their home, community centers, medical facilities, helped living centers, and more. The work environment of an LCSW differs depending on their location of specialization.

Is a LCSW thought about a physician?
LCSWs have the capability to provide psychiatric therapy to their clients, however, their training focuses on connecting their clients with the resources and abilities required to satisfy their needs. LCSWs can easily work together with psychiatrists and physicians to develop thorough treatment plans for clients.

While those in the field of psychiatry can go on to medical school and earn their Medical professional of Medicine, the master’s in social work (MSW) is the highest level of education that LCSWs acquire. But depending upon an LCSW’s career goals, they might choose to complete a DSW program down the line.

Just how much does a LCSW make?
As of May 2020, the median annual wage for social workers was $51,760 External link: open_in_new, according to the BLS. The salary of an LCSW differs based on factors such as their employer, specialized, and the amount of time they work. Lots of social workers tend to work full-time, but some may be on call.

Social work licensure in Pennsylvania can take 6 to 12 years. For a provisional license, a social worker should work for a minimum of three years after their BSW prior to using. It can take 7 years to get this short-lived social worker license or online social work degree. For the LSW, a social worker requires at least an MSW, which can take one to three years of extra education, depending on if the trainee participates in full time or part time or begins in innovative standing. Typically, it takes 2 years to complete an MSW; the LSW does not need post-degree experience. A social worker can gain LSW licensure in 6 years. For the LCSW, a candidate should obtain an LSW and after that accumulate 3,000 hours of supervised experience, which can take 6 years. It can take 12 years of combined education and experience to end up being an LCSW.

A psychologist is a social scientist who is trained to study human habits and psychological processes. Psychologists can work in a range of research study or medical settings. Psychology degrees are available at all levels: bachelor’s, master’s, or doctorate (PhD or PsyD). Postgraduate degree and licensing are required for those in independent practice or who provide client care, including scientific, counseling and school psychologists.

PhD programs in medical psychology emphasize theory and research study approaches and prepare students for either academic work or careers as practitioners. The PsyD, which was produced in the late 1960s to address a scarcity of specialists, emphasizes training in therapy and counseling. Psychologists with either degree can practice therapy however are required to complete a number of years of supervised practice before ending up being licensed.

A psychologist will detect a mental illness or issue and determine what’s best for the client’s care. A psychologist often operates in tandem with a psychiatrist, who is also a medical doctor and can prescribe medication if it is determined that medication is essential for a client’s treatment. Psychologists can do research study, which is an extremely essential contribution academically and medically, to the profession.
